Perhaps what is needed is a "back to the basics" teaching: God the Father, God the Son, God the Holy Spirit, and the Adversary, Satan! Someone once said that the greatest deception Satan has ever propagated was he doesn't exist! According to recent research, it seems to be working! The Barna Group says in an article, "Barna Survey Examines Changes in Worldview Among Christians over the Past 13 Years," that "Just one-quarter of adults (27%) are convinced that Satan is a real force. Even a minority of born again adults (40%) adopt that perspective. Also, "A minority of American adults (40%) are persuaded that Jesus Christ lived a sinless life while He was on earth. Slightly less than two-thirds of the born again segment (62%) strongly believes that He was sinless.
